Core Viewpoint - Changcheng Life Insurance has received an administrative warning from the Hebei Securities Regulatory Bureau for failing to cease trading shares of Xintian Green Energy after reaching a 5% stake, violating relevant regulations [1][3][5]. Group 1: Regulatory Actions - On December 9, the Hebei Securities Regulatory Bureau issued a warning letter to Changcheng Life Insurance for violating securities laws during its share acquisition of Xintian Green Energy [1][3]. - The company increased its holdings in Xintian Green Energy by 1 million shares on September 23, bringing its total to 21.04 million shares, which is 5.0027% of the total share capital, thus reaching the threshold for disclosure [1][5]. - The warning has been recorded in the securities and futures market integrity file, and the company is required to submit a written report to the regulatory bureau within 15 days [6]. Group 2: Financial Performance - Changcheng Life Insurance's third-quarter performance showed a stark contrast, with investment returns improving year-on-year, while insurance business revenue and net profit both declined significantly, with net profit dropping by 70.92% [1][9]. - The company's insurance business revenue for the first three quarters was 21.455 billion yuan, down 5.92% year-on-year, while net profit was 156 million yuan, a decrease of 70.92% [9]. - Despite the challenges in profitability, the company reported an investment return rate of 4.65% and a comprehensive investment return rate of 6.07%, both of which increased year-on-year [9]. Group 3: Capital and Solvency - As of the end of the third quarter, Changcheng Life Insurance's total assets reached 165.916 billion yuan, a 21% increase from the beginning of the year [9]. - The company's core and comprehensive solvency adequacy ratios were 102.21% and 153.84%, respectively, both showing a decline from the previous quarter [10]. - The core tier one capital decreased by 17% to 11.329 billion yuan, with a slight forecasted increase to 11.576 billion yuan for the next quarter [10].

Core Viewpoint - The surge in insurance companies acquiring stakes in listed firms is accompanied by compliance issues, as evidenced by the warning letter issued to Great Wall Life Insurance by the Hebei Securities Regulatory Bureau due to non-compliance with trading regulations [1][2] Compliance Issues - Great Wall Life Insurance's internal compliance system has significant gaps, highlighted by its failure to halt trading after reaching a 5% stake in New Tian Green Energy, violating relevant regulations [2][3] - The company acknowledged the violation was not due to a lack of understanding of the rules but rather a failure in the dynamic monitoring and execution of trading activities [3] Financial Performance - Despite being active in the capital market, Great Wall Life Insurance reported a significant decline in both premium income and net profit, with a 5.92% drop in insurance business revenue to 21.455 billion yuan and a 70.92% decrease in net profit to approximately 156 million yuan in the first three quarters [4] - The company experienced a 12.46% decline in signed premium income, totaling 22.905 billion yuan, with new policy premiums down 43.04% to 6.228 billion yuan, while renewal premiums increased by 9.5% [4][5] Strategic Adjustments - In response to external pressures, including declining government bond rates, Great Wall Life Insurance has shifted its product strategy, increasing the proportion of dividend-type products to nearly 70% of new policy premiums [5] - The company aims to enhance its profit management capabilities and shareholder value through a dual approach of asset and liability management [4] Regulatory Penalties - Great Wall Life Insurance has faced multiple regulatory penalties for compliance failures, including a fine of 50,000 yuan for improper sales practices and a 5,000 yuan fine for providing external benefits to policyholders [6] - The company recognizes the need for improvements in its sales management and compliance systems, committing to a comprehensive overhaul of its internal controls to prevent future violations [6]
